Sponsored Research Services

Sponsored Research Services (SRS) facilitates the administration of externally sponsored projects at Cincinnati Children’s. SRS is a central office organized around the primary functions of pre-award, sponsored programs compliance, and contracts. SRS provides support and assistance to investigators and division administrators on the preparation, submission, administration, compliance and management of grants and contracts. Sponsored Research Services partners with Post-Award Accounting for award set-up, award modifications, and award management.

SRS provides communication, education and training to the Cincinnati Children’s research community on topics such as proposal preparation, contracting and subcontracting, and sponsored programs compliance.

Sponsored Research Services Pre-Award

SRS Pre-Award is responsible for facilitating the submission of proposals to external sponsors. The Pre-Award team assists investigators and division administrators in the preparation of the administrative components of proposals, reviewing and authorizing submission of all proposals, and serving as the primary liaison between Cincinnati Children’s and external sponsors.

Sponsored Research Services Contracts

SRS Contracts issues, reviews, negotiates, and executes research-related agreements with federal, industry, foundation, and other sponsors.  This team also prepares and negotiates budgets and contracts for industry sponsored clinical trials.

Sponsored Research Services Compliance

SRS Compliance is responsible for managing inquiries related to safeguarding sponsored project funds.  SRS Compliance serves as the main point of contact for subrecipient monitoring, A-133 audit, and various aspects of internal monitoring and control.  In addition, SRS Compliance manages the sponsored project effort reporting process and is operationally responsible for monitoring cost transfers and other transactions involving sponsored projects.
